Applications
Piperdial, CAS 100288-36-6, is used as an intermediate in organic synthesis with applications across multiple industries. In fragrance and perfumery, it can function as an odorant or fragrance fixative precursor. In cosmetics and personal care, it may serve as a fragrance ingredient within formulations. In household products and industrial manufacturing, it is commonly employed as an intermediate for the synthesis of polymers and coatings. It is also often evaluated for pharmaceutical synthesis as an intermediate in chemical processes.
